Everything Everything Announces New Album A Fever Dream for August 2017 Release

Everything Everything release a new song called “Can’t Do” along with a music video to tease their new album
A Fever Dream.

The music video, directed by Holly Blakely and the song was a vision of trying to send the message that normal doesn’t exist and that the goal should be to shape the world around you.

“Can’t Do” is about trying to bend to the world and fit into it,” singer Jonathan Higgs said. “Nobody is normal, nobody knows what normal is. ‘I can’t do the thing you want’ – we don’t care we just want you to dance.”

A Fever Dream will be a follow up to the critically acclaimed album Get to Heaven, which was ranked at number seven on the United Kingdom Albums Chart, and at number 29 on the Australian albums chart.
